GNU patch
Development
GNU patch is an open-source utility for applying patches to text files. It allows users to modify source code files by applying differences files, also known as patches, which contain the changes between two versions of a file.

Zapya
File Sharing
Zapya is a free file sharing app that allows you to transfer files and share content with others nearby without an internet connection. It uses Wi-Fi or Bluetooth to send documents, photos, videos, and other media between devices.
